Just like a piece of jewellery you might wear for purely sentimental reasons, so too for the art and many of the objects we choose for our homes.
This artwork was painted by my grandmother Ethel Glubb over 30 years ago. At the age of 65, after having 9 children and dedicating her life to her family, she travelled alone to Russia and Europe.
While travel is commonplace now, it was not so in 1980 for a woman in her 60’s. Inspired by the art and culture she experienced, Ethel returned to New Zealand and became immersed in art.
Talented and driven, she was accepted to the Ilam School of Fine Arts where her world continued to expand beyond family, meeting other artists and younger students from all walks of life.
In the early 90’s she was part of a group show at the Centre of Contemporary Art in Christchurch where this artwork and many of her other beautiful pieces were on show.
It was painted from her studio window in the late afternoon sun, overlooking the rooftops in Christchurch. She captured a moment in time, before the skyline changed, buildings fell in the earthquake and life moved on.
Standing in front of this artwork, that I have looked at a thousand times over 30 years, happiness blooms in my heart. It means more to me than any piece of art I could have purchased from a catalogue or online.
Authentic, hand-painted, imperfect.
An original art work that reminds me of my grandmother and the inspiration she continues to be to me.
